Saudi Arabia Offers Safe Return for Dissidents Without Consequences

Saudi Arabia is offering a path for dissidents to return to the Kingdom without facing any consequences, according to the Head of the Presidency of State Security, Abdulaziz al-Howairini. This initiative aims to reintegrate individuals who have previously opposed the government. Al-Howairini emphasized that dissidents who have been used by external forces to criticize Saudi Arabia are welcome to come back, provided their opposition has been limited to ideological disagreements and they have not been involved in criminal activities.

The Saudi official made these comments during an appearance on MBC’s Hikayat Waad program. He reassured the public that dissidents would not face any legal actions if they had not participated in criminal acts within the Kingdom. Al-Howairini also stated that the country would not publicize the names of those returning. Instead, the Kingdom’s priority is rehabilitation, not punishment.

Dissidents interested in returning are encouraged to contact the designated number, 990, to provide their personal details and current location. Alternatively, they can have a family member reach out to authorities on their behalf. This initiative reflects Saudi Arabia’s approach to counterterrorism and extremism, which focuses on support and reintegration rather than punitive measures.

The episode of Hikayat Waad also covered Saudi Arabia’s broader counterterrorism efforts. Al-Howairini highlighted the critical role Saudi society plays in combating extremism. He noted that approximately 20% of detainees in the country were arrested either at the request of their families or through cooperation with them. This cooperation demonstrates the strong partnership between the government and the public in maintaining security and stability.
